This role will cover Switzerland and Austria is a remote role. This means your home/remote location is the primary work location. There may however be requirements to attend a Medtronic location for meetings from time to time.
Responsibilities may include the following and other duties may be assigned
- Coordinate and execute initial training sessions for using the CathWorks (CWX) suite, including shadowing users, providing theoretical training, and assisting with first clinical procedures
- Support the adoption of the CWX suite during the early implementation phase by collaborating with local Sales Representatives (SRs) and ensuring activities are tracked and measured in coordination with the WE HQ team
- Conduct follow-up training sessions for new and existing users, particularly when new tools or functionalities are introduced
- Train local SRs during live and demo cases to help them achieve certification in proficient usage of technology
- Assist local commercial teams (SRs, Marketing) in delivering product presentations and demo cases in target accounts
- Provide "train the trainer" resources to hospital staff, enabling them to independently train their personnel on the CWX suite
Required Knowledge and Experience
- Bachelor's degree in biomedical engineering or a closely related field
- Minimum 4 years of experience in Computer Science or technology implementation within the healthcare industry, with a focus on medical systems integration
- Strong knowledge of angiograms and cardiac anatomy, with demonstrated expertise in imaging technologies
- Proven project management skills, including the ability to plan, coordinate, and execute programs while meeting timelines and objectives
- Exceptional customer service and communication skills to resolve problems proactively and collaborate with diverse stakeholders, including healthcare professionals and hospital staff
- Willingness and ability to travel extensively, up to 80% of the time, within the country of residence and across key European Union (EU) countries
- Good knowledge of written and spoken German and English
